INSTITUTE OF INTERNATIONAL EDUCATION INC, founded in 1919, is a major nonprofit in the International Affairs sector that reported $395.5M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ue grew 14%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$343.9M left a modest 13% surplus.

Mission

HELP PEOPLE AND ORGANIZATIONS LEVERAGE THE POWER OF INT'L EDUCATION - CONTINUED IN SCHEDULE OTO THRIVE IN TODAY'S WORLD THROUGH SCHOLARSHIP, EXCHANGE, SCHOLAR RESCUE, AND OTHER HIGHER EDUCATION PROGRAMS.
